Mountaineering
Ø Successfully completed a 26-day Basic Mountaineering Course during July 2003 conducted by the Directorate of Mountaineering and Allied Sports, Manali, Himachal Pradesh, India. The course included basic mountaineering techniques like rock climbing, river crossing, high altitude trekking, camping, snow and ice crafting and also height gaining to 16,500 feet.

KAILASH MANASAROVAR TREK

I successfully completed a 28-day trekking expedition in India and Tibet organized by the Ministry of External Affairs, Government of India. A brief itinerary of the trek undertaken during July 2006 is given below.

Overland Route – India
Ø Bangalore - New Delhi – Kathdodam – Bhimtal – Almora – Dharchula - Mangti

Trekking Route – India to Tibet
Ø Mangti – Gala – Budhi – Gunji (3500 m) – Kalapani – Navidang (3370 m) – Lipulekh Pass (5334 m) = 87 km

Overland Route – Tibet
Ø Taklakot – Zaidi – Parakha – Darchen

Trekking Route – Tibet – Circumambulation of Mt. Kailash
Ø Darchen – Deraphuk - Foot of Mt. Kailash – Deraphuk - Dolma La Pass (5550 m) – Zongzerbu – Darchen = 55 km

Trekking / Bus Route – Tibet – Circumambulation of Lake Manasarovar
Ø Darchen – Qihu – Qugu – Qihu = 35 km

Trekking Route – Tibet to India
Ø Lipulekh Pass - Navidang – Kalapani – Gunji – Budhi – Gala – Mangti = 87 km
Overland Route – India
Ø Mangti - Dharchula – Jageshwar – New Delhi – Bangalore

The total trekking distance was approximately 264 km.
